Chandigarh 08th June:-Dr. Dhandapani SS, Associate professor of Neurosurgery in PGI, Chandigarh, has been honored with "NextGen Young Neurosurgeon Award" selected by a jury of eminent neurosurgeons in the "6th International Neurosurgery Update of Asian Australasian Society of Neurological Surgeons" in Mumbai. This is for his work on "Minimally invasive keyhole approach for clipping aneurysms in Subarachnoid hemorrhage". This method may be highly cost effective compared to other modes of minimally invasive treatments available for these aneurysms. He had previously completed Minimally Invasive & Endoscopic Neurosurgery Fellowship in Weill Cornell, New York, USA.

Chandigarh 08th June:-It was a not less than a miracle of sort for Rajasthan couple,  whose baby after the 20-yr of marriage, survived and ready to discharg as healthy like other babies despite having born as premature and weighing only 600-gram at the time of birth.

Now 3-month & 5-day old and having weight of 2.3-kg, the baby boy is all set to be discharged from IVY Hospital, Mohali tomorrow with normal growth and neurological development as per his age. 

Interestingly there have been very few such instances of such low birth weight babies having been saved in the country.

He was just equal to my palm size when he was born as caesarian on February 28 night, recalled Dr. Rashmi Pandove, chief pediatrician and new born care specialist at IVY Hospital while addressing a press conference at Chandigarh Press Club today.

Dr. Rashmi Pandove further informed that since the boy was born prematurely we have to create conditions similar to the mother's womb to help the infant develop naturally. In the initial one week the baby's weight was decreased to 450-gram. Due to prematurity the baby was immediately shifted to NICU and was given intratracheal surfactant for lung maturity and was put on ventilator.

Baby was initially given total parenteral nutrition due immaturity of intestines. He also had patent ductus arteriosus which is type of congenital heart disease and for this baby was medically managed. The eyes of these babies are also not fully formed and are prone to develop Retinopathy of prematurity which happened in this micro primie as well for which laser was done. The baby also had other temporary problems such as apnea of prematurity, neonatal insulin resistance, infection, jaundice and anemia.

Meticulous care was taken using all aseptic precautions. Every potential complication was pre-empted and corrected then and there. Each day was a fresh challenge. The child was in fact become the darling of the whole hospital with everyone enquiring about his well-being as if it were their own . The efforts borne fruits as baby started to gain daily weight increase of 20-30 grams, pointed out Dr. Kanwaldeep, Medical Director, Ivy Group of Hospitals
The mother Manjit Kaur ( 45) has given proper training to handle the baby as in the past few days we have tried to keep him with his mother, asserted Dr. Kanwaldeep.  

Meanwhile Dr Rashmi has set up a level 3 Neonatology unit at IVY hospital where she uses her expertise to provide the highest quality of medical care to the new born babies.

Chandigarh 08th June:-As a preparatory activity for control of Malaria and Dengue in the coming season the Malaria wing of Health Department, UT-Chandigarh today organized Health Awareness camp and  advocacy workshop at Village Burail.         

The awareness camp was attended by Dr. Inderpal Singh-Epidemiologist, Dr. Navneet Kanwar (Medical Officer I/c CH-45), and staff from the Malaria wing, opinion leaders and general public from the area.

Dr. Inderpal Singh stressed on active community participation at all levels to prevent occurrence of mosquitogenic situation in the area. He outlined the preventive steps for this purpose and assured continuance of anti larval and anti adult measures for mosquitoes with full zeal in the season. He also urged all to maintain vigil over the water borne diseases in the area.

Various teams were constituted by the NVBDCP Staff for carrying following field activities. 50 slides were examined during the camp. An Entomological Exhibition was organized for public awareness. Display of sign and symptoms of Malaria as well as hand bills distribution amongst the general public was also done.

A rally was also flagged off by the Officers and local leaders of Village Burail for creating awareness for prevention and control of vector borne diseases.

Chandigarh 08th June:-TI Cycles of India, one of the leading bicycle manufacturers in India and a part of the Murugappa Group, announced the inauguration of its state-of-the-art-bicycle manufacturing factory in Rajpura, Punjab on 9th, June 2016. This facility - a Greenfield project, is set up with the support of the Government of Punjab. This factory has been set up to cater to the growing demand in the North and East Indian markets.

The plant has been built with a capital expenditure of Rs.105 Crores and has the capacity to manufacture 2.50 lakhs cycles per month, with the ability to expand when required. It is a state-of-the-art plant with the most modern bake-on-bake painting technology. The plant will have three modern painting lines with German applicators. This new plant at Rajpura will further enhance the company's ability to bring in innovative new products to cater to changing consumer needs. It will also help the company to continually improve the quality of its products on par with best in the world.

This plant is an environment-friendly factory with zero-discharge and100% recycling of water. It will soon have a 350kW rooftop mounted solar panel installation to take care of part of the energy needs of the factory.

Located in Sandharsi village, Rajpura Tehsil of Patiala District Punjab, this plant has been set up with the support of the Punjab Bureau of Investment Promotion. Apart from contributing to the development of the ancillary industry in Punjab, this will also offer employment opportunities (both direct and indirect) to around 3000 people.

Speaking on the occasion, TII Chairman and Murugappa Group Vice Chairman MM Murugappan said that we are very happy to be a part of the industrial activity in Punjab. We already have a factory manufacturing Tubes in Mohali which is running successfully.  We are encouraged by the positive industrial climate in Punjab and the support extended by the Government. This plant will cater to the demand of bicycles in the North and Eastern parts of India.

Chandigarh 08th June:-UTI Balanced Fund declares tax-free dividend of 5% (Rs. 0.50  per unit on face value of Rs.10/) under dividend option-existing plan and dividend option direct plan. Pursuant to the payment of dividend, the NAV of the dividend option-existing plan and dividend option-direct plan of the scheme would fall to the extent of payout.

The record date for the dividend is June 13, 2016. 

All unit holders registered under the dividend option-existing plan and dividend option- direct plan of UTI Balanced Fund as on the record date will be eligible for this dividend. Also investors who join the dividend option -existing plan and dividend option-direct plan of the scheme on or before the cut off time of the record date will be eligible for the dividend.

The NAV of UTI Balanced Fund on June 7, 2016 under dividend option-existing plan was Rs.28.2721 and under dividend option-direct plan was Rs. 28.6505. 

UTI Balanced Fund is an open-ended balanced fund which aims to invest in a portfolio of equity/equity related securities and fixed income securities (debt and money market securities) with a view to generating regular income together with capital appreciation.
